Writing Tips to Market Your Business

When it comes to marketing your business online with well-written blogs, email blasts, and social media, you better know what you are doing. Otherwise, you will be wasting your valuable time and money. Not only do you have to deliver a favorable product or service, but you have to keep the general public informed of your business. The last thing you want to do is annoy them with too many posts, emails and messages, or you will quickly get spammed.

To start, put yourself in your potential and repeat customers’ shoes. Would you like to receive a text message discussing this week’s sale every single day? Probably not. You also need to do a little research on content marketing. What is your target audience reading and chatting about online? Are they excited about a new product you will soon have in stock? If so, make sure to attract buyers, as well as search engines, by discussing it in your content in creative writing. How will you offer the product in a more attractive way than your competition?

When it comes to your internet content writing, be quick and precise. Think of blogs, email blasts, and social media as fast food for the masses. Consumers want their information delivered swiftly and easy, without clicking through or reading too much content. However, a business still needs quality content that gets right to the point. If you have any words thrown in that add no value to your message, get rid of them. The internet is no place for fluff. Depend on creative writing when writing shorter content that gets right to the point.

In your content writing, educate your targeted customers before you try to sell them your unique product or service. Earn trust, along with a strong readership. Then when they need to go shopping, your business will be a click away.

How to Write High Ranking Blogs

Planning to create a blog to attract new consumers and keep in contact with current customers, as well as attract search engines with the right keywords? If so, there are some basics you need to know, including choosing the best terms in original content and relying on the most effective links within your website’s writing to attract a targeted audience of buyers.

Picking ideal keywords is essential for search engines like Google to recognize your site. That’s why you need to pick first-rate terms and phrases to avoid the wrong traffic. If you are selling ice cream cones in Fort Lauderdale, focusing your keywords on Florida ice cream is too vague. You will end up paying for potential customers in Jacksonville who are searching the web for “how many calories are in rocky road.”

You should also rely on Google Trends to figure out the most popular search terms for a given time. On Friday, a new movie in the theaters may be the most popular search term. However, the Miami Dolphins will be the most popular term on Sunday. Integrate the keywords naturally into your content, including your heading, subheading, title, URL, meta description, photo title, and content. Optimal keywords can improve your search results tremendously.

Take advantage of links to respectable website’s content in your blog. Think of these links as references. Connect to influential sites like Wikipedia and CNN.com, rather than your friend’s Twitter post. This shows readers and search engines that you’ve performed valid research.

Another little trick to attract search engines is to write longer content. While the human eye prefers seeing shorter blogs, you should write at least a few hundred words. Keep paragraphs short and remember to integrate your most productive keywords to attract Google, along with paying customers.

Successful Blog Tactics

In today’s business world, there’s a pretty good chance that you or somebody at your business currently writes a blog. But how do you know if it is cost effective? It all has to do with how much time goes into the reporting, as well as getting it online. How many readers actually look at it? Is the blog being shared on other sites, and is the writing putting money into your business’s bank account?

A team of web design and development experts in Chicago took a look at more than one thousand bloggers and their content over the last three years to track trends on the digital market. In 2014, writers usually spent less than 2 hours putting together a post. They were also short, usually containing far less than 1,000 words. Several posts would go up throughout the week, with a giant proportion of the blogs being posted on social media websites. The research found that bloggers were always producing, even outside typical office hours.

The following year, 2015, more and more professional bloggers began to appear on the web. Overall, formal writers spent a little bit more time every week creating and posting their work, and the average size of a blog shot up to 1,500 words. Photos became more popular as on blogs as well.

By the time 2016 rolled around, the time taken to write blogs shot up more than 25%. In fact, the number of writers who spend a minimum of six hours on a blog doubled. In other words, the quality of blogging has become more important to the business world. Content matters, along with backlinks and keyword targeting. The trend will only continue throughout 2017.
